The total number of scientific publications in Artificial Intelligence in Canada is forecasted to increase steadily from 522.68 in 2024 to 574.73 by 2028. From 2024 to 2025, there is a year-on-year increase of 2.5%, and a similar annual growth rate is observed through 2028. If this trend remains consistent, the comp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) over the five years is expected to be approximately 2.4%.
In 2023, the number of AI publications stood at 510, representing a steady growth trend as we move into future years. The increase in publications indicates rising academic and industry interest in AI, fostering innovation and advancement within the sector.
